A great extra service has recently been added for our Publishers. We have now added the ability to display offer markdown information within the Catalogue API Product Service.
Previously, we offered actual price information tagged as <price> within the <Offer> element. Now we additionally provide the original price and related markdown percentage to allow for display of markdown information for each offer. In the event an offer is not on sale, the response will return a markdown percentage of “0.00″.
Sample XML:
<price integral=”29999“>£299.99</price>
<originalPrice integral=”39999“>£399.99</originalPrice>
<markdownPercent integral=”25.00“</markdownPercent>
The release of these new fields should not impact you unless you have developed a means of auto-generating your XML handling code based on the XML schema document for the Product Service. If you have done this, you will need to update your schema.

Tim also gave a very detailed tip for WordPress users interested in using Dynamic Assets. While we cannot be held liable for any code you may accidentally break (read our FAQ), Tim’s advice has brought GPSReview much success:
Create the Dynamic Asset using just the letter “a” in the “Search For” field as the keyword. Pick the banner size, set your colors, etc, and then get the HTML code. Look in the HTML code for the following:
/keyword-a/
Replace that with this:
/keyword-<?php echo(urlencode(strtolower(single_post_title(”,FALSE)))); ?>/
That code should take the title of the WordPress post and use it as the keyword for the ad unit.
Keep in mind, this will be optimal only for those publishers using the product name as the blog post title. Hopefully, this will help you save time by making our dynamic assets… well… more dynamic! As always, please contact us with any questions or comments.

Shopzilla's Publisher is expanding further into European markets
The Shopzilla Publisher program has finally expanded across the water and launched in both France and Germany. Widely known in France as one of the top five price comparison websites, Shopzilla.fr saw great interest expressed in its Publisher program at the E-commerce tradeshow in Paris in September. Equally, German reaction to the program proved unequivocal at Munich’s DMexco conference in late September where the program was met with much eagerness.
With the Publisher program growing steadily in the UK after its introduction of dynamic assets to the affiliate world, reception in these two previously Shopzilla-untouched European affiliate markets was very enthusiastic. Of particular interest at both the German and French conferences was the FTP data feed product, which allows publishers the chance to download either partly or wholly Shopzilla’s merchant inventory, adding a slice of the price comparison pie to their websites.
Unique to Shopzilla, the wide range of advertising options enables Shopzilla publishers to choose amongst custom text links, search boxes and top search result display banners, to name but a few, as well as to really customise the content with new integrated tools.
